The Spain Semiconductor Silicon Wafer Market is experiencing steady growth driven by increasing demand for electronic devices, automotive applications, and renewable energy technologies. The market is primarily dominated by key players such as Siltronic AG, Shin-Etsu Chemical Co., Ltd., and SUMCO Corporation. The demand for advanced semiconductor wafers, including those made from 300mm and 450mm silicon, is on the rise due to the expansion of the Internet of Things (IoT) and artificial intelligence (AI) industries. Additionally, the growing adoption of 5G technology and electric vehicles in Spain is expected to further fuel the demand for semiconductor silicon wafers. However, challenges such as fluctuating raw material prices and supply chain disruptions may impact market growth in the near term.

Export potential enables firms to identify high-growth global markets with greater confidence by combining advanced trade intelligence with a structured quantitative methodology. The framework analyzes emerging demand trends and country-level import patterns while integrating macroeconomic and trade datasets such as GDP and population forecasts, bilateral import–export flows, tariff structures, elasticity differentials between developed and developing economies, geographic distance, and import demand projections. Using weighted trade values from 2020–2024 as the base period to project country-to-country export potential for 2030, these inputs are operationalized through calculated drivers such as gravity model parameters, tariff impact factors, and projected GDP per-capita growth. Through an analysis of hidden potentials, demand hotspots, and market conditions that are most favorable to success, this method enables firms to focus on target countries, maximize returns, and global expansion with data, backed by accuracy.
By factoring in the projected importer demand gap that is currently unmet and could be potential opportunity, it identifies the potential for the Exporter (Country) among 190 countries, against the general trade analysis, which identifies the biggest importer or exporter.
